The Diving and Dive Profiles
The weather determines which side of
Cayman we dive on. Generally the wind is predominately from the North East which means that the majority of
Cayman Islands Scuba Diving is done on the West side along the Seven Mile Beach area, where most of the hotels and condo’s are situated.

We generally depart from the Public Beach area along Seven Mile Beach between 7.30am and 7.45am. If the weather co-operates, we depart from the
Cayman Islands Yacht Club, to dive the North wall. This early departure time guarantees that we will be one of the first boats out, which means that we get the pick of all the
Grand Cayman Diving sites.
Our first dive is usually a guided Wall dive. The 'walls' here in
Cayman generally start at around 45 feet in depth and can go down to about 3000 feet. Our maximum profile is 100 feet so you can choose you own comfort zone and extent your bottom time accordingly.

After a surface interval of usually an hour, our second dive is typically a shallow reef or wreck dive, and you can choose if you want to be guided or not. Each dive site we visit is determined firstly with safety being our number one concern.
